Duties


Serves as the primary staff director for developing joint integration plans, joint training, joint Professional Military Education and exercise programs, and to develop the action plans to implement approved joint strategies for the department.

Provides direction and oversight of the planning for stationing and implementing approved joint force development, supporting operational planning, evaluating and disseminating joint doctrine, developing and managing education and professional development, training exercises, readiness, and assessment.

Plans, and coordinates joint exercises to facilitate joint and interagency operations, the integration and implementation of new systems and capabilities, and Joint Staff professional and technical training programs.

Responsible for development of the State long- range force integration plan. Analyzes the management of the State Force Integration Program. Analyzes information provided on conflicts identified, substantive changes and doctrinal issues, and the recommended courses of action. Provides JFHQ-State input to Combatant Commander's war plans, with emphasis on homeland defense/homeland security.

Assists local, state and federal government and other agencies in the preparation of supporting plans, programs, activities, exercises and training.

Functions as JFHQ-State officer of primary responsibility for the Department of Defense (DoD) Training Transformation (T2) program. Plans, coordinates, and conducts joint exercises to facilitate joint and interagency operations. Oversees and manages JFHQ-State joint assessment and lessons learned programs. Administers Joint Professional Military Education programs. Plans, conducts, and evaluates JFHQ-State joint professional and technical training programs.

Serves as the senior strategic and long-range planner and consultant responsible for developing the Joint Force Headquarters-State view of the future and implements detailed strategic policy, plans, initiatives and concepts related to war fighting, theater security cooperation, international relations, federal and state homeland security, civil support missions, and selected other activities for the entire organizations based on broad guidance from higher headquarters and specific guidance from the Adjutant General and Chief of the Joint Staff.

Reviews Department of Defense (DoD), Department of the Air Force (DAF), Department of the Army (DA), National Guard Bureau (NGB), Army National Guard (ARNG), Air National Guard (ANG) and other agency planning documents (i.e.

National Military Strategy, Defense Planning Guidance, Quadrennial Defense Review, etc.) and ensures the state strategic plan remains synchronized with current topics, future initiatives and higher headquarters planning documents.

Keeps abreast of technical advances in the test and evaluation field, analyzes and recommends adjustments and changes to policies, programs, and projects to improve operations and efficiencies throughout the state.

Conducts statewide analysis for strategic planning, re-engineering issues, and program integration.

Synchronizes and integrates strategies with Combatant Commanders, NGB, other services, supported federal and state agencies, and the federal response plan.

Engages and works with directorate strategic planners and functional management teams to ensure proper planning and analysis for future force structure activities including capabilities analysis, demographic information, and ongoing transformation planning for out-year activities.

Provides direction and guidance to directors and staff in enhancement measurement tools and management improvement ideas.

Conducts and oversees the completion of detailed studies in response to the state Adjutant General and Chief Joint Staff requests and prepares executive summaries, information papers and briefings for internal and external audiences.

Studies are typically characterized by command group visibility, with significant importance to higher headquarters and staff. Tasks are unique in nature requiring the development of stand-alone processes and techniques to formulate decisions or policy. Employs advanced management principals, data compilations and the development of recommendations to affect current sources, infrastructure and future requirements.

Provides oversight on the coordination and administration of activities and programs which integrate military and non-military agencies and international programs as directed by NGB, Combatant Commanders (CoComs), Department of State, and other appropriate tasking authorities.

Performs other duties as assigned.

Requirements

Conditions of Employment
  • NATIONAL GUARD MEMBERSHIP IS REQUIRED.

If you are not sure you are eligible for military membership, please contact a National Guard recruiter prior to applying for this position.

This is an excepted service position that requires membership in a compatible military assignment in the employing state's National Guard, required prior to the effective date of placement.

Selectee will be required to wear the military uniform. Acceptance of an excepted service position constitutes concurrence with these requirements as a condition of employment.

Applicants who are not currently a member of the National Guard must be eligible for immediate membership and employment in the National Guard in the military grade listed in this announcement.

Males born after 31 December 1959 must be registered for Selective Service. Federal employment suitability as determined by a background investigation. May be required to successfully complete a probationary period. Participation in direct deposit is mandatory.

Qualifications

Military Grades:
O2-O6

SPECIALIZED EXPERIENCE :
one year of specialized experience in the applicable career field at the GS-11 level or at a level comparable in difficulty and responsibility to the GS-11 level if Military or outside the Federal service

Quality of Experience - Length of time is not of itself qualifying.

Candidates' experience should be evaluated on the basis of duties performed rather than strictly on the rank of the individual; however, established compatibility criteria/assignments must be followed.

The applicant's record of experience and/or training must show possession of the knowledge, skills and abilities needed to fully perform the duties of the position.
